About Junhang
Junhang, a name rooted in Mandarin Chinese, carries a truly uplifting and aspirational spirit. Its meaning, a blend of "talented," "outstanding," "handsome," "brave," and even "soaring" or "navigating," paints a picture of a child destined for greatness and adventure. This contemporary, positive choice is perfect for parents who value names that convey strong, meaningful attributes and a sense of forward momentum. Unlike many modern names that simply sound pleasant, Junhang actively speaks to a desired character, offering a daily affirmation of potential. It’s a distinctive option for those who appreciate cultural depth and a name that inspires.
